Lotus 1-2-3 for DOS R2.3/2.4 Wysiwyg Driver
Here is your 1-2-3 for DOS Release 2.3 and 2.4 Update package to install a
H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X printer driver used to create output from the
Wysiwyg (:Print) publishing environment of 1-2-3 for DOS. This driver is
not available in 1-2-3 native-mode (/Print) or PrintGraph.
Lotus' driver for the H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X printer is enhanced to
support PCL5 and HP-GL/2 to take advantage of internal scalable fonts and
vector graphics drawing for superior performance. Lotus and HP have
worked closely together to ensure that as many of the new capabilities of
the H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X printer as possible are supported by 1-2-3 for
DOS.
Lotus and Hewlett-Packard hope that the H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X printer
driver meets your needs.
H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X Printer Features Supported:
Fonts
On Board Scalable Font Selection
CG Times, Univers, Albertus, Antique Olive,
Garamond Antiqua, CG Omega
HP-GL/2
Full Vector Graphics Drawing
True Text Rotation
PJL Support
PCL5 Language Switching
Paper Handling
Two Input Bins
INSTALLATION NOTES:
Before proceeding with the update, please make sure there is at least 1.3
megabytes of hard disk space available on the disk containing your 1-2-3
program. This amount of disk space is required temporarily to allow the
update to create copies of the files that will be modified. This is done
to insure that the integrity of all files being affected remains intact
during the update procedure.
To install the driver from the Printer Driver disk, follow these instructions:
1. Insert the Update disk in drive A: (or B:)
2. At the operating system prompt, type A: (or B:) and press ENTER to make
A: (or B:) the current drive.
3. At the prompt, type DRIVE4Si
A) At the main menu, select Lotus 1-2-3 Version 2.3, 2.4
B) Select Copy Driver File(s)
C) Enter the path of your Release 2.3 or 2.4 directory, and then press
ENTER. For example, if you have Release 2.3 and your directory is
C:\123R23, you would type C:\123R23 and then press ENTER.
When the update is complete, the following message
appears: "To take advantage of the new printer driver, you must now
run the 1-2-3 Install program."
4. You must now run the Install program. Follow the instructions in chapter
4 of Getting Started (if you have Release 2.3) or chapter 5 of Getting
Started (if you have Release 2.4) to start Install.
A) In the 1-2-3 Install program, choose "Change selected equipment"
and then choose "Add New Drivers to the Library" and identify the drive
A: (or B:) containing this Update disk. When Install indicates that it
has completed adding the new drivers, choose "Return to Main Menu".
B) Choose "Select Your Equipment" from the Install Main Menu and follow
the instructions on the screen. The new printer driver provided on
this disk is a "Graphics printer", its name will appear in Install's menu
as: "HP LaserJet 4Si PCL5"
C) Make sure you select "Yes" when Install asks if you want to "Generate
Fonts".
If you have multiple driver sets, you must recreate each
driver set using "Select Your Equipment".

APPLICATION NOTES:
1-2-3 for DOS will automatically use internal scalable typefaces resident
in your printer when you select to use the "HP LaserJet 4Si PCL5" driver
in Wysiwyg, the publishing environment which is part of 1-2-3 for DOS.
If you have a 1-2-3 spreadsheet which you would like to try printing with
your new H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X printer driver, just "/File Retrieve" it.
Make sure that you select the appropriate driver and interface through
Wysiwyg's ":Print" menu or through the dialog box. Then choose ":Print
Range Set", and when your printer is ready, choose ":Print Go".
Refer to your 1-2-3 User's Guide if you need more information on printing
with 1-2-3's Wysiwyg or the ":Print" menu(s).
The following fonts in 1-2-3's Wysiwyg display will automatically map to
your H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X printer:
Swiss => CG-Universe Dutch => CG-Times
You can also select the H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X printer fonts by name
through the Wysiwyg menu ":Format Font Replace (1-8) Other".
Then:
"Select the typeface"
"Fontsize in points"
Please keep in mind that 1-2-3's Wysiwyg display can not show you the
actual font available on your printer. Moreover, you may notice that the
spacing between characters changes on screen when you've selected to use a
font available in your H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X printer. This is done to
indicate the width of characters as they will appear on your printed
output.
HP LaserJet 4Si/4Si MX Printer Fonts Selectable Through Wysiwyg:
CG Times HP-TIMES.IFL
Univers HP-UNVRS.IFL
Albertus HPALBERT.IFL
Antique Olive HPANTOLV.IFL
Garmond Antiqua HPGARAMD.IFL
CG Omega HPOMEGA.IFL

SPECIAL NOTES:
If you are using Virus Scanning Software
This modification will alter existing files, which may cause a
virus checking program to report a virus.
If you are using a virus scanning program that is memory resident,
you may wish to disable the resident virus scanner before proceeding
with the update, and re-enable it afterwards.
If you are using a non-memory resident virus scanning program that
maintains a record of files on your disk, you may receive a report that
some files in the 1-2-3 directory you updated have been modified since
they were was last scanned. You may wish to have the virus scanner re-scan
your 1-2-3 directory immediately following this modification in order to
update the record of the 1-2-3 files.
===========================================================================
ERROR MESSAGES
"ERROR: There is not enough free disk space.
1.3MB of free disk space is temporarily needed to perform the update."
This indicates that insufficient disk space is free on the drive
containing the 1-2-3 files you are updating. 1.3 megabytes of disk space
is required temporarily to allow the update to create copies of the files
that will be modified. This is done to insure that the integrity of all
files being affected remains intact during the update procedure.
